2. Safety Information
To ensure safe use of this product, please observe the following guidelines:
- Always assemble the daybed on a soft, clean surface to prevent damage to the product or your floor.
- Ensure all parts are securely fastened before use. Periodically check and retighten all connections.
- Do not allow children to play on or around the daybed without supervision.
- Do not exceed the maximum weight capacity: 275 lbs for the main bed and 175 lbs for the trundle.
- Keep small parts away from children during assembly to prevent choking hazards.
- Use only the recommended mattress sizes for twin beds. Box springs are not required.

5. Operating Instructions
The KLMM Extending Daybed offers versatile sleeping arrangements:
- Standard Twin Daybed: When the trundle is stored underneath, the unit functions as a twin-size daybed, suitable for seating or a single sleeper.
- Twin Bed with Trundle: To use the trundle, gently pull it out from under the main daybed. The trundle is equipped with smooth-rolling casters for easy extension. This provides an additional twin-size sleeping surface.

Figure 4: Trundle Extended
- King-Size Configuration: For a larger sleeping area, the trundle can be pulled out and elevated to the same height as the main daybed, effectively creating a king-size sleeping surface.

6. Maintenance and Care
Proper care will extend the life and appearance of your daybed:
- Cleaning: Wipe the wooden surfaces with a soft, damp cloth. Avoid using harsh chemicals, abrasive cleaners, or excessive moisture, as these can damage the finish.
- Dusting: Regularly dust the frame with a dry, soft cloth.
- Hardware Check: Periodically inspect all bolts and screws to ensure they remain tight. Retighten as necessary to maintain stability.
- Avoid Direct Sunlight: Prolonged exposure to direct sunlight can cause wood finishes to fade or crack.
- Mattress Care: Follow the care instructions provided with your mattresses.
7. Troubleshooting
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Daybed feels unstable or wobbly. | Loose hardware. | Check and tighten all bolts and screws. Ensure all connections are secure. |
| Trundle is difficult to pull out or push in. | Obstruction or damaged casters. | Check for any objects blocking the trundle's path. Inspect casters for damage or debris and clean if necessary. |
